xetown의 로그인창을 띄워서 익스플로러나 브라우저의 크기를 줄였다 늘렸다 해보세요.

항상 가운데 위치해있죠?

이걸 알려드리겠습니다.

 

 

방법은 부모레이어와 자식레이어가 필요합니다.

 

1) 부모레이어에 속성을

display:flex로 지정합니다.

 

2) 자식레이어에 속성을

min-height: 100vh;
    align-items: center;
    display:flex;
justify-content: center;
    flex-direction: column;

이렇게 지정해줍니다.

 

최종 소스는 이걸 참조하시면 되구요

https://codepen.io/chriswrightdesign/pen/emQNGZ

 

css의 flex 속성은 익스11에서만 가능하지 싶은데요.

구글검색 : css flex center ie

https://www.w3schools.com/cssref/css3_pr_flex.asp

https://css-tricks.com/snippets/css/a-guide-to-flexbox/

여기에서 좀 더 알아보실 수 있습니다.

이온디

profile
이온디는 라이믹스를 비롯한 다양한 CMS의 시드뱅크를 꿈꿉니다. 여러분들이 사랑하는 웹소스를 언제든지 사용할 수 있게 하기 위해 이온디는 매일 소스코드를 유지보수하고 있으며, 언제든지 다운로드할 수 있는 소스마켓을 운영하고 있습니다.

#XE마켓 - 이온디스토어
https://eond.com/xemarket/

# XE/라이믹스 단톡방을 운영 중입니다. (비번: 2022)
https://open.kakao.com/o/giaKKnl

# XE/라이믹스 생활코딩 모듈 강좌입니다.
https://opentutorials.org/module/3774
  • profile
    CSS는 세로 중앙정렬을 정말 쓸데없이 어렵게 만들어 놨죠... ㅜㅜ
  • profile profile
    진짜 매번 느낍니다 ㅎㅎ